How Vacuum Mop Cleaner Robots Work: A Symphony of Technology
The magic behind vacuum mop cleaner robotics depends on their complex blend of hardware and software. These gadgets seamlessly incorporate vacuuming and mopping abilities, running autonomously to deliver a detailed cleaning experience. Comprehending their inner workings is important to valuing their effectiveness and selecting the best design for particular requirements.
At their core, vacuum mop cleaner robotics utilize a combination of innovations to browse and clean efficiently. Here's a breakdown of their essential operational elements:
Navigation and Mapping: Modern robot vacuum mops make use of sophisticated navigation systems to comprehend and map their cleaning environment. Lots of high-end models employ LiDAR (Light Detection and Ranging) technology, which uses lasers to create a comprehensive map of the space. This enables for efficient cleaning courses, organized room protection, and obstacle avoidance. Other robots may use camera-based visual SLAM (Simultaneous Localization and Mapping) or count on infrared sensing units and gyroscopes for navigation. Easier models may employ a more random or bounce-based navigation system, which, while less effective, still gets the job done gradually.
Vacuuming System: The vacuuming function is typically powered by a motor that creates suction. This suction, combined with turning brushes beneath the robot, raises dust, dirt, pet hair, and other debris from the floor. Collected particles is then transported into an internal dustbin. The suction power and brush style can vary between designs, affecting their effectiveness on different floor types and in getting numerous types of dirt.
Mopping System: This is where vacuum mop robotics truly separate themselves. They are geared up with a water tank and a mopping pad. Water is given onto the pad, which is then dragged or turned across the floor surface area. Different designs utilize different mopping mechanisms:
- Dragging Mop Pads: These are the most basic and most typical. The robot drags a damp microfiber pad throughout the floor.
- Vibrating Mop Pads: Some robots include vibrating mop pads that scrub the floor better, loosening tougher spots and gunk.
- Turning Mop Pads: More advanced designs use turning mop pads that simulate manual mopping actions, supplying a much deeper tidy and better stain elimination capabilities.
- Sonic Mopping: Premium robotics incorporate sonic vibration technology, creating high-frequency vibrations in the mopping pad for extremely effective scrubbing.
Sensors and Intelligence: A range of sensors are crucial for robot operation. Cliff sensing units prevent robots from dropping stairs. Bump sensing units spot challenges. Wall sensing units allow for edge cleaning. The robot's software and algorithms procedure sensor information to make intelligent decisions about cleaning courses, barrier avoidance, and going back to the charging dock when the battery is low or cleaning is total. Numerous robots now provide smartphone app integration, allowing functions like scheduling, zone cleaning, and real-time tracking.

Browsing the marketplace: Types of Vacuum Mop Robots
The market for vacuum mop cleaner robotics is diverse, with different models accommodating various needs and budget plans. Comprehending the different types can help you make an informed choice:
2-in-1 Vacuum and Mop Robots: These are the most typical type, integrating both vacuuming and mopping functionalities in a single system. They normally switch between modes or operate both concurrently depending upon the model.
Dedicated Vacuum Robots with Mopping Attachment: Some robots are primarily designed for vacuuming however use a detachable mopping module. These might be a great choice for those who prioritize strong vacuuming abilities but want occasional mopping functionality.
Dry Mopping vs. Wet Mopping Robots: While essentially all "mop" robotics provide damp mopping to some level, some are much better suited for primarily dry sweeping and light moist mopping for dust removal. Others are created for more robust wet mopping with features like adjustable water circulation and scrubbing pads.
Navigation Technology Based Classification:
- LiDAR Navigation Robots: Offer the most exact navigation, effective cleaning paths, and advanced functions like room mapping, zone cleaning, and no-go zones.
- Camera-Based Navigation Robots: Use visual SLAM for mapping and navigation, frequently providing good protection and item recognition.
- Infrared and Gyroscope Navigation Robots: More budget-friendly choices that use sensors and gyroscopes for navigation, normally less methodical and effective than LiDAR or camera-based systems.
- Random/Bounce Navigation Robots: Basic designs that move randomly, altering instructions upon encountering obstacles. While less efficient, they can still clean up effectively over time, especially in smaller areas.
Feature-Based Classification:
- Self-Emptying Robots: These robots immediately empty their dustbins into a bigger base station, substantially lowering maintenance frequency.
- App-Controlled Robots: Offer smart device app combination for scheduling, push-button control, zone cleaning, real-time mapping, and more.
- Smart Home Integration Robots: Compatible with voice assistants like Alexa or Google Assistant, enabling for voice-activated cleaning commands and automation within smart home ecosystems.
Secret Considerations: Choosing the Right Robot for Your Home
With a large range of alternatives available, picking the best vacuum mop robot requires careful factor to consider of your specific requirements and home environment. Here are some key aspects to evaluate:
- Floor Type Compatibility: Consider the types of floor covering in your house. Some robotics perform better on difficult floorings, while others are created to manage carpets and rugs effectively. Look for brush type and suction power viability for your floor surfaces.
- Suction Power: Higher suction power is normally better for getting pet hair, ingrained dirt, and debris from carpets and rugs. For primarily hard floors, moderate suction might be adequate.
- Mopping Effectiveness: Evaluate the mopping system. Think about whether you require light damp mopping for dust elimination or more robust damp mopping for stain elimination. Functions like vibrating or rotating mop pads boost mopping performance.
- Battery Life and Coverage Area: Ensure the robot's battery life and protection area suffice for cleaning your whole home in a single charge. Examine the maker's specs and consider your home's size.
- Navigation and Mapping System: For bigger homes or those with complicated layouts and multiple spaces, LiDAR or camera-based navigation is highly advised for effective cleaning and systematic protection.
- Features: Consider wanted features like app control, scheduling, zone cleaning, no-go zones, self-emptying, and smart home combination based on your way of life and choices.
- Upkeep Requirements: Think about the upkeep involved. Self-emptying robots minimize dustbin emptying frequency. Examine the ease of cleaning brushes, replacing filters, and preserving mopping pads.
- Budget: Robot vacuum mops range in rate from economical to premium. Identify your spending plan and prioritize functions that are crucial to you.
Keeping Your Robot Running Smoothly: Maintenance and Care
To ensure your vacuum mop robot vacuums uk continues to perform optimally and takes pleasure in a long life-span, routine upkeep is essential. Basic upkeep tasks can substantially affect its effectiveness and durability:
- Empty the Dustbin Regularly: This is crucial for preserving suction power. Empty the dustbin after each cleaning cycle or as regularly as recommended by the maker. For self-emptying robots, make sure the base station dustbin is likewise emptied occasionally.
- Tidy the Brushes: Hair, threads, and particles can get tangled in the brushes. Routinely remove and clean the brushes to maintain their effectiveness. Some robots come with cleaning tools specifically created for this function.
- Tidy or Replace Filters: Filters trap dust and irritants. Routinely clean or replace filters according to the manufacturer's instructions to maintain excellent air quality and suction.
- Tidy the Mopping Pads: Wash or replace mopping pads regularly to keep hygiene and mopping effectiveness. Follow the producer's standards for cleaning or replacing pads.
- Check and Clean Sensors: Sensors are important for navigation. Periodically clean sensors with a soft, dry cloth to guarantee they are devoid of dust and particles, keeping accurate navigation.
- Preserve Water Tank (if appropriate): For robots with water tanks, routinely tidy the tank and guarantee it is devoid of mineral accumulation. Use distilled water if recommended by the producer to avoid mineral deposits.
- Software Updates: If your robot is app-controlled, keep the robot's firmware and app updated to gain from performance enhancements and new functions.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) about Vacuum Mop Cleaner Robots
Q: Are vacuum mop cleaner robotics worth the cash?A: For many, the answer is yes. The time and effort conserved, combined with consistently tidy floorings and the benefit of automated cleaning, typically outweigh the preliminary investment. Consider your lifestyle and how much you value your time and cleanliness when making this choice.
Q: Can robot vacuum mops replace regular vacuums and mops entirely?A: For daily cleaning and maintenance, they can substantially minimize or perhaps get rid of the requirement for conventional vacuums and mops. Nevertheless, for deep cleaning, taking on large spills, or cleaning upholstery and other surface areas, you might still need a conventional vacuum or mop.
Q: Do robot vacuum mops deal with all floor types?A: Most modern-day robotics work well on tough floors like tile, hardwood, laminate, and vinyl. Many can also deal with low-pile carpets and carpets. However, very thick carpets or shag carpets may pose obstacles for some designs. Constantly check the maker's specs for floor type compatibility.
Q: What sort of upkeep is required for a vacuum mop robot?A: Regular upkeep includes clearing the dustbin, cleaning brushes, cleaning or replacing filters, cleaning mopping pads, and regularly cleaning sensors. Upkeep frequency differs depending upon use and the specific design.
Q: How long do vacuum mop robotics typically last?A: The life expectancy of a robot vacuum mop depends upon usage, upkeep, and develop quality. Usually, with proper care, a good quality robot can last for numerous years (3-5 years or more). Battery life may degrade in time and might ultimately require replacement.
Q: Are vacuum mop robots safe for family pets and kids?A: Generally, yes. They are developed to navigate around obstacles. However, it's constantly sensible to monitor family pets and little kids initially to ensure they do not hinder the robot's operation or vice versa. Keep little things and cables out of the robot's path to avoid entanglement.
Q: Can robot vacuum mops climb stairs?A: No, a lot of robot cleaner vacuum mop cleaner robot mops are developed for single-level cleaning. They are equipped with cliff sensing units to avoid them from falling down stairs, however they can not climb up stairs themselves. For multi-level homes, you would normally need a robot for each level or by hand move the robot between floorings.

Q: How loud are vacuum mop robots?A: Noise levels vary in between models. Normally, they are quieter than standard vacuum. Numerous run at a sound level similar to a peaceful conversation. Some designs offer a "peaceful mode" for even quieter operation.
Q: Can I use cleaning services in the water tank of a robot mop?A: It is essential to inspect the producer's suggestions. Some robots are developed to just use plain water in the water tank. Using specific cleaning solutions can harm the robot or void the service warranty. If permitted, utilize just moderate, diluted cleaning options particularly approved for robot mops.
